Re: [Line6linux-user] line6 edit equivalent
Status: Pre-Alpha
Brought to you by:
mgrabner
|
From: Stefan H. <ste...@gm...> - 2013-01-15 16:10:21
|
On Tue, Jan 15, 2013 at 4:24 PM, <jea...@fr...> wrote: > Idea of web based converter is good, but i'm afraid their is no docs on file > format ? Yes, in general working on POD stuff requires reverse-engineering either USB traffic captures, MIDI dumps, or .h5e patch files. > I could help a little if reading and writting the pod parameter are > include in the driver. > > I've seen some stuff in the sys dir but how to use them ? Almost all of the POD functionality is accessed via MIDI. I have pasted my notes for POD HD300 below to get you started. The device sends MIDI messages when you press buttons, switch amp models, etc so it's pretty easy to figure out the MIDI mapping using the amidi(1) utility to dump MIDI messages. Stefan POD -> Host: Volume pedal: B0 07 XX (XX - 0 to 7F) Tap tempo: F0 00 01 0C 14 00 63 00 02 XX XX XX XX F7 (XX - ?) Mode: F0 00 01 0C 14 00 63 00 04 15 00 00 XX F7 (XX - 00 preset, 01 looper, 02 stomp) Preset: C0 XX (XX - 00 Preset 1A, ..., 7F Preset 32D) Looper Pre/Post: F0 00 01 0C 14 00 63 00 04 01 00 00 XX F7 (XX - 00 Pre, 01 Post) Amp Stomp Off/On: F0 00 01 0C 14 00 63 00 02 14 00 00 XX F7 (XX - 00 Off, 01 On) FX1 Stomp Off/On: F0 00 01 0C 14 00 63 00 10 03 00 00 XX F7 (XX - 00 Off, 01 On) FX2 Stomp Off/On: F0 00 01 0C 14 00 63 00 11 03 00 00 XX F7 (XX - 00 Off, 01 On) FX3 Stomp Off/On: F0 00 01 0C 14 00 63 00 12 03 00 00 XX F7 (XX - 00 Off, 01 On) Wah Pedal Off/On: ? Amp Model: B0 0B XX F0 00 01 0C 14 00 63 00 00 0A 00 00 XX F7 XX - Model 01 - BF Dbl Nrm 02 - Hiway 100 03 - Super O 04 - Gibtone185 05 - B-Man Nrm 06 - BF Lux Nrm 07 - Divide9/15 08 - PhD Mtrway 09 - Class A-15 0A - ClassA30TB 0B - J-45 Brt 0C - P-75 Brt 0D - Brit J-800 0E - BomberUber 0F - Treadplate 10 - ANGL FBall 11 - BF Dbl Vib 12 - B-Man Brt 13 - BF Lux Vib 14 - J-45 Nrm 15 - P-75 Nrm 16 - L6Elektrik 17 - Plexi Nrm 18 - Plexi Brt 19 - Solo Clean 1A - SoloCrunch 1B - Solo OD 1C - L6 Doom 1D - L6 Epic 1E - Flip Top Amp Type Full/Preamp: F0 00 01 0C 14 00 63 00 02 25 00 00 XX F7 (XX - 00 Full, 01 Preamp) Cab Model: F0 00 01 0C 14 00 63 00 02 13 00 00 XX F7 XX - Model 01 - 212-BlkF 02 - 412-Hway 03 - 6x9-Supr 04 - 112-FdCl 05 - 410-Twd 06 - 112-'Lux 07 - 112-12H 08 - 212-Port 09 - 112-Blue 0A - 212-SvBl 0B - 412-Gr25 0C - 412-Bk30 0D - 412-T75 0E - 412-Uber 0F - 412-Trd 10 - 412-XXL 11 - 115-Flip 12 - None Mic Model: F0 00 01 0C 14 00 63 00 02 24 00 00 XX F7 XX - Model 00 - 57 On Xs 01 - 57 OffXs 02 - 409 Dyn 03 - 421 Dyn 04 - 4038 Rbn 05 - 121 Rbn 06 - 67 Cond 07 - 87 Cond Early Reflections: F0 00 01 0C 14 00 63 00 00 13 XX XX XX F7 (XX - ?) Presence: F0 00 01 0C 14 00 63 00 02 1D XX XX XX F7 (XX - ?) Master: F0 00 01 0C 14 00 63 00 02 2A XX XX XX F7 (XX - ?) Sag: F0 00 01 0C 14 00 63 00 02 27 XX XX XX F7 (XX - ?) Hum: F0 00 01 0C 14 00 63 00 02 26 XX XX XX F7 (XX - ?) Bias: F0 00 01 0C 14 00 63 00 02 28 XX XX XX F7 (XX - ?) Bias Excursion: F0 00 01 0C 14 00 63 00 02 29 XX XX XX F7 (XX - ?) Bypass Volume: F0 00 01 0C 14 00 63 00 02 15 XX XX XX F7 (XX - ?) Amp Drive: F0 00 01 0C 14 00 63 00 02 01 XX XX XX F7 (all XXs identical) B0 0D XX (XX - 00 to 7F) Amp Bass: B0 0E XX F0 00 01 0C 14 00 63 00 02 02 XX XX XX F7 (all XXs identical) (XX - 00 to 7F) Amp Mid: B0 0F XX F0 00 01 0C 14 00 63 00 02 03 XX XX XX F7 (all XXs identical) (XX - 00 to 7F) Amp Treble: B0 10 XX F0 00 01 0C 14 00 63 00 02 04 XX XX XX F7 (all XXs identical) (XX - 00 to 7F) Channel Volume: B0 11 XX F0 00 01 0C 14 00 63 00 02 05 XX XX XX F7 (all XXs identical) (XX - 00 to 7F) FX Only Off/On: F0 00 01 0C 14 00 63 00 04 16 00 00 XX F7 (XX - 00 Off, 01 On) FX1 Model: F0 00 01 0C 14 00 63 00 10 00 00 00 XX F7 XX - Model: 01 - Screamer 0B - Tube Drive 0C - ClassicDis 0D - Heavy Dist 0E - ColorDrive 0F - Overdrive 10 - L6 Drive 11 - L6 Dist 12 - Boost Comp 13 - Red Comp 14 - Blue Comp 16 - Vetta Comp 18 - Fuzz Pi 19 - OctaveFuzz 1A - Jet Fuzz 1B - SubOctFuzz 1D - FacialFuzz 1E - Jumbo Fuzz 02 - Spring 23 - ParmetrcEQ 24 - 4BndShftEQ 27 - Tron Down 28 - Tron Up 29 - Q Filter 2A - Ring Mod 2B - Dimension 2C - FreqShiftr 2D - RotaryDrum 03 - SmrtHarmny 2F - PitchGlide 31 - SynthStrng 32 - Growler 33 - SynthOMatic 34 - BassOctavr 35 - V-Tron 5E - VintagePre 5F - HardGate FX1 Routing Pre/Post: F0 00 01 0C 14 00 63 00 10 01 00 00 XX F7 (XX - 00 Pre, 01 - Post) FX1 Param1: F0 00 01 0C 14 00 63 00 20 01 XX XX XX F7 FX1 Param2: F0 00 01 0C 14 00 63 00 20 02 XX XX XX F7 FX1 Param3: F0 00 01 0C 14 00 63 00 20 03 XX XX XX F7 FX1 Param4: F0 00 01 0C 14 00 63 00 20 04 XX XX XX F7 FX1 Param5: F0 00 01 0C 14 00 63 00 20 05 XX XX XX F7 FX2 Model: F0 00 01 0C 14 00 63 00 11 00 00 00 XX F7 XX - Model 04 - AnlgChorus 36 - AnlgFlange 37 - U-Vibe 38 - Phaser 39 - DualPhaser 3A - Barberpole 3B - PanndPhasr 3C - ScriptPhas 3D - Pitch Vibr 05 - Seeker 3E - Throbber 3F - Spin Cycle 40 - Obi Wah 41 - Voice Box 06 - Opto-Trem 42 - Bias Tremo 43 - PattrnTrem 44 - Panner FX2 Pre/Post: F0 00 01 0C 14 00 63 00 11 01 00 00 XX F7 (XX - 00 Pre, 01 Post) FX2 Tap Control: F0 00 01 0C 14 00 63 00 11 04 00 00 XX F7 (XX - 00 Don't Control, 01 - Control) FX2 Param1: F0 00 01 0C 14 00 63 00 21 00 XX XX XX F7 FX2 Param2: F0 00 01 0C 14 00 63 00 21 01 XX XX XX F7 FX2 Param3: F0 00 01 0C 14 00 63 00 21 02 XX XX XX F7 FX2 Param4: F0 00 01 0C 14 00 63 00 21 03 XX XX XX F7 FX2 Param5: F0 00 01 0C 14 00 63 00 21 05 XX XX XX F7 FX3 Model: F0 00 01 0C 14 00 63 00 12 00 00 00 XX F7 XX - Model 07 - Digi Delay 45 - DigDlyWMod 46 - AnalogEcho 47 - AnlgEchMod 48 - EchoPlattr 49 - EchPltrStd 4A - LoResDelay 4B - Stereo Dly 4C - Ping Pong 4D - Dynmic Dly 08 - Tape Echo 4E - TapeEchStd 4F - Tube Echo 50 - TubeEchStd 09 - AutoVolume 52 - Sweep Echo 53 - SwpEchStud 54 - Reverse FX3 Pre/Post: F0 00 01 0C 14 00 63 00 12 01 00 00 XX F7 (XX - 00 Pre, 01 Post) FX3 Tap Control: F0 00 01 0C 14 00 63 00 12 04 00 00 XX F7 - (XX - 00 Don't Control, 01 Control) FX3 Time: F0 00 01 0C 14 00 63 00 22 00 XX XX XX F7 (XX - ?) FX3 Tempo: F0 00 01 0C 14 00 63 00 02 06 XX XX XX F7 (XX - ?) FX3 Param1: F0 00 01 0C 14 00 63 00 22 01 XX XX XX F7 (XX - ?) FX3 Param2: F0 00 01 0C 14 00 63 00 22 02 XX XX XX F7 (XX - ?) FX3 Param3: F0 00 01 0C 14 00 63 00 22 03 XX XX XX F7 (XX - ?) FX3 Param4: F0 00 01 0C 14 00 63 00 22 04 XX XX XX F7 (XX - ?) Reverb Model: F0 00 01 0C 14 00 63 00 13 00 00 00 XX F7 XX - Model 0A - Plate 55 - Room 56 - Chamber 57 - Hall 58 - Cave 5A - Octo 5B - Tile 5C - Echo Reverb Pre/Post: F0 00 01 0C 14 00 63 00 13 01 00 00 XX F7 (XX - 00 Pre, 01 Post) Reverb Pre-delay: F0 00 01 0C 14 00 63 00 23 02 XX XX XX F7 (XX - ?) Reverb Decay: F0 00 01 0C 14 00 63 00 23 01 XX XX XX F7 (XX - ?) Reverb Tone: F0 00 01 0C 14 00 63 00 23 03 XX XX XX F7 (XX - ?) Reverb Mix: F0 00 01 0C 14 00 63 00 23 05 XX XX XX F7 (XX - ?) Gate Mode: F0 00 01 0C 14 00 63 00 02 0C 00 00 XX F7 (XX - ?) XX - Model 00 - Off 01 - Gate 02 - Noise Reduction 03 - Gate + Noise Reduction Gate Threshold: F0 00 01 0C 14 00 63 00 02 0A XX XX XX F7 (XX - ?) Gate Decay: F0 00 01 0C 14 00 63 00 02 0B XX XX XX F7 (XX - ?) Wah Model: F0 00 01 0C 14 00 63 00 02 12 00 00 XX F7 (XX - ?) XX - Model 00 - Vetta 01 - Fassel 02 - Chrome 03 - Weeper 04 - Cnductor 05 - Colorful Volume Pre/Post: F0 00 01 0C 14 00 63 00 02 07 00 00 XX F7 (XX - 00 Pre, 01 Post) Volume Min: F0 00 01 0C 14 00 63 00 02 08 XX XX XX F7 (XX - ?) Volume Max: F0 00 01 0C 14 00 63 00 02 09 XX XX XX F7 (XX - ?) Live: F0 00 01 0C 14 00 63 00 04 18 00 00 XX F7 XX - Model 00 - ComboFrt 01 - ComboAmp 02 - StackFrt 03 - StackAmp AutoFX: F0 00 01 0C 14 00 63 00 04 02 00 00 XX F7 (XX - 00 Disabled, 01 AmpSetFX) USB Monitor Volume: F0 00 01 0C 14 00 63 00 04 19 XX XX XX F7 (XX - ?) Footswitch Mode: F0 00 01 0C 14 00 63 00 04 1B 00 00 XX F7 (XX - 00 Normal, 01 Hold4Lpr) AC Rate: F0 00 01 0C 14 00 63 00 04 1C 00 00 XX F7 (XX - 32 50Hz, 3C 60Hz) Tap Tempo Light: F0 00 01 0C 14 00 63 00 04 04 00 00 XX F7 (XX - 00 AlwaysOn, 01 Flash 8) |